Q: the computer equips with Pentium E5300, UNIKA UG41MX motherboard and 2GB RAM primarily, and I want to update for it. Some friends say that it would be OK to add one GT210 graphic card. Also some say upgrade like this has no big effect. Suggest changing to GT240 graphic card. But I worry once update like this, the power has to be replaced too; I also worry whether other accessories would affect the exertion of the display card performance.
A: now for current such configuration, it’s really of no necessity to update GT210 graphic card, because if you do this, the efficiency after upgrade is not that obvious. Suggest updating to GT240. as for concrete models, you can consider Zotac GT240-512D5 destroyer (reference price is around 90 USD). After updating like this, the performance of the entire machine would have an obvious improvement, besides, it could get mainstream configuration. As for power aspect, as long as the original rating power reaches 250W, then it’s ok, there should be of no big problem on power as estimated. As for the entire platform, after updating GT240, the performance of the entire machine is kind of average, no bottleneck; as other accessories would not affect the update effect.
